    Gut health restoration at Kure Health uses the GI-MAP (GI Microbial Assay Plus) with quantitative PCR technology to measure bacterial balance, parasites, yeast overgrowth, digestive enzyme function, inflammation markers, and immune response — combined with zonulin testing for intestinal permeability. As part of Signal-Based Medicine™, we connect gut dysfunction to its downstream effects: autoimmune activation, mood disorders, hormone disruption, weight resistance, and chronic fatigue.

    Your Gut Isn't Just Your Gut. It's Running the Show.

    90% of your serotonin is made in your gut. 70% of your immune system lives there. Your gut bacteria activate thyroid hormone, metabolize estrogen, produce B vitamins, and regulate inflammation. When someone says 'gut health,' they're actually talking about the operating system of your body. We don't treat your gut as a specialty. We treat it as the foundation of every other system.
